In today's digital age, cables can quickly turn our spaces into chaotic messes, making it essential to implement effective cable management hacks. One of the simplest solutions is to utilize cable ties or Velcro straps. These can help bundle together multiple cables, keeping them neat and organized. Another genius hack is to use command hooks or adhesive clips to secure cables along walls or under desks. This not only reduces clutter but also prevents accidental yanks that can lead to damage.
Additionally, consider repurposing everyday items to manage your cords. For example, a toilet paper roll can act as a simple cable organizer—just decorate it and label each roll for quick identification. Another effective technique is employing cable boxes to conceal power strips and excess cords, providing a clean look without sacrificing functionality. By implementing these five genius cable management hacks, you can create a clutter-free space that enhances productivity and aesthetic appeal.

Creating an effective cable management system at home is essential for both aesthetics and safety. Begin by gathering all your cables and devices in one area. Assess how many cables you have, including those for electronics like TVs, computers, and gaming consoles. Once you have everything in one place, consider using cable ties or zip ties to bundle cables together, which not only keeps them organized but also minimizes the risk of tripping over loose wires. You can also implement a cable management box to hide excess cables and power strips, providing a cleaner look to your living spaces.
Next, label your cables for easy identification. You can use label makers or simple adhesive labels to tag each cable with its corresponding device. This step is especially helpful when troubleshooting or rearranging tech setups. For larger spaces, consider installing cable raceways or cable sleeves along walls or behind furniture to keep unsightly cables out of sight. By following these tips, you can achieve a seamless and efficient cable management system that enhances your home's functionality and visual appeal.
Is your desk a jungle of cables? If you find yourself battling a tangle of cords every time you reach for your charger or headset, it's time to take action. Taming the chaos starts with organization. Begin by identifying the cables you use regularly and those that have become relics of the past. Create a designated space for essential cables, such as using cable trays or clips to keep them neat and out of the way. Labeling each cable can also help prevent future mix-ups, making it easy to identify what you need at a glance.
Once you've sorted through your cables, consider investing in cord management solutions. Products like cable sleeves, zip ties, or even decorative boxes can create a more aesthetically pleasing workspace. Additionally, try implementing a plan for regular maintenance—set a reminder to review your setup every few months to ensure your desk remains an organized haven instead of a chaotic jungle. With these tips, you'll not only enhance the functionality of your workspace, but you’ll also promote better productivity and reduce frustration during your workday.
